    Ruigh Aiteachain bothy is recently renovated, of stone and tin construction. It's well equipped with a composting toilet (please follow instructions carefully) and fireplace which can be used with wood supplied by the estate.

    The bothy sleeps 10.

      This is a true gem of a bothy! It was renovated in 2019 and has a fireplace. There is a caretaker that is kind of resident here and seems so sleep in one of the attic rooms. The bothy has plenty of room inside and also for tents outside. You will find two pit toilets that need to be flushed with buckets. There is also spring water nearby. It is a great basecamp for bagging the munros in the area.

      The place can get a little busy on weekends and especially during the TGO challenge. We had 20 tents one night.

        The Glen Feshie is an outstanding area to explore and this bothy is certainly worthy of it place.

        Composting toilets and heated showers (on request from the managing estate), a large and sociable downstairs and 2 attic rooms to sleep 10. Fires are highly discouraged in the Glen but this bothy has an outdoor fire/BBQ pit along with a plentiful supply of wood.

        The quality of facilities and ease of access does mean it’s popular though!
